Explore printable Copying Practice worksheets for Kindergarten
Kindergarten copying practice worksheets through Wayground (formerly Quizizz) provide essential foundational training for developing fine motor skills and letter recognition abilities. These carefully designed printables guide young learners through systematic copying exercises that strengthen hand-eye coordination, pencil grip, and spatial awareness while building familiarity with letter shapes and formations. Each free worksheet collection includes structured practice problems that progress from simple shapes and lines to more complex letter patterns, ensuring students develop the muscle memory necessary for confident handwriting.
